Eliminate A, and D:
1. Usage of "IF" makes sentence conditional, which the sentence is not.
2. Pronoun "IT" creates ambiguity

A. How a hearing problem is treated depends on
if it stems from a malfunctioning of the inner ear or of the auditory nerve,
also known as the cochlear nerve.
D. if it stems from a malfunctioning of the inner ear or of the auditory nerve,
also known as the cochlear nerve,
determines how a hearing problem is treated.


[b]Eliminate C, and D: Pronoun "IT" Error, creating ambiguity[/b]
C. How a hearing problem is treated depends on
whether it will stem from a malfunctioning of the inner ear or of the auditory nerve,
also known as the cochlear nerve.
E. Whether it stems from a malfunctioning of the inner ear and of the auditory nerve,
also known as the cochlear nerve,
determines how a hearing problem is treated.

B. How a hearing problem is treated depends on
whether the problem stems from a malfunctioning of the inner ear or of the auditory nerve,
also known as thecochlear nerve.
Correct
